Cisco WS-F6K-DFC4-E Full Official Technical Specification Document
1. Product Overview
Official Full Designation
Cisco WS-F6K-DFC4-E:Distributed Forwarding Card 4 Standard Memory Daughter Card for Catalyst 6500 E-Series WS-X68xx / WS-X69xx Interface ModulesCisco
WS-F6K-DFC4-E is a dedicated daughter card integrated onto Cisco Catalyst 6500 E-Series 6800-series and 6900-series Ethernet line cards, exclusively designed to work with Supervisor Engine 2T / 2TXL (VS-S2T-10G) equipped with PFC4-E forwarding enginesCisco. It delivers localized distributed Cisco Express Forwarding (dCEF) processing directly on the line card, offloading packet forwarding and advanced service tasks from the supervisor’s centralized PFC4 engine to eliminate chassis-wide forwarding bottlenecks and scale overall switching performanceCisco.
Core DefinitionDFC4-E is a compact pluggable daughter board pre-installed factory-standard on all base SKUs of WS-X68xx (WS-X6808-10G-2T, WS-X6816-10G-2T, WS-X6848-SFP-2T, WS-X6848-TX-2T) and WS-X69xx high-speed line cards. It replicates the full functional ASIC architecture of the supervisor’s PFC4-E forwarding engine, providing independent line-rate packet lookup, security, QoS, multicast, and NetFlow services locally for all ports on its host line cardCisco. It features standard memory sizing for enterprise campus and medium-scale data center deployments, contrasted with the expanded high-memory variant WS-F6K-DFC4-EXL for large-scale carrier and high-flow-density data center environmentsCisco.

Mandatory Supervisor Engine Requirement
Only compatible with Supervisor Engine 2T / VS-S2T-10G (equipped with PFC4-E centralized forwarding engine). Fully incompatible with Supervisor Engine 720 (DFC3 architecture), legacy Supervisor 1A, Supervisor 2, Supervisor 32 platforms.

Core Integrated Functional Capabilities
DFC4-E mirrors all PFC4-E hardware service functions locally on the line card, eliminating forwarding traffic hairpinning to the supervisor engine:
-
Full hardware dCEF distributed packet forwarding for IPv4 unicast/multicast, IPv6 unicast/multicast, MPLS label switching, and Layer 2 bridging
-
Hardware-accelerated security Access Control Lists (ACLs): ingress/egress port ACLs, VLAN ACLs, router ACLs
-
Hardware QoS processing: DSCP/CoS traffic classification, policing, marking, ingress queuing, egress DWRR/SRR scheduling, WRED congestion avoidance, CBWFQ
-
Dedicated hardware multicast replication engine for efficient Layer 2/Layer 3 multicast traffic distribution
-
Hardware NetFlow v5/v9 flow collection, flow statistics aggregation, and export processing
-
EtherChannel load-balancing calculation, packet rewrite lookup, and rewrite statistics collection
-
Full jumbo frame support up to 9216 bytes, VSS Virtual Switch Link traffic forwarding, hot-swappable OIR line card failover synchronization
2. Hardware & Performance Specifications
Core Forwarding & Memory Performance
-
Forwarding Throughput Capacity: 60 Mpps line-rate distributed packet forwarding per DFC4-E daughter cardCisco
-
FIB (Forwarding Information Base) Capacity: Standard 256,000 IPv4 unicast forwarding entries
-
TCAM Memory Allocation:
-
ACL TCAM: 64,000 security ACL entries
-
NetFlow TCAM: 512,000 concurrent NetFlow flow cache entries
-
Memory Hardware: 3 x 600 MHz RLDRAM3 high-speed memory chips for forwarding table storageCisco
-
Switch Fabric Interface: Dual full-duplex 20 Gbps switch fabric channels (40 Gbps aggregate bidirectional bandwidth) connecting the host line card to the chassis crossbar fabric
